Ayuda OnLine de GULiC

Anon5392

Ayuda
  • Temática: Puedes preguntarnos sobre Software Libre, Linux o GULiC. Otros temas pueden ser respondidos (o no!)
  • Acceso: Para mantener tu anonimato, se te ha asignado un nick al azar (Anon5392). Si deseas identificarte, puedes solicitar tu inscripción como socio ó iniciando sesión, si ya lo eres. En cualquier caso, si usas jabber, puedes informarte de cómo entrar a esta sala con tu cliente habitual, o bien entrando vía jwchat.
  • Uso: Para ver el chat más grande, usa ésta página. Si vas a pegar textos grandes, mejor usa nuestro pastebin. Para avisar de errores o problemas, usa nuestro trac.
  • Horarios: Nuestro huso horario es WET. No te extrañe si a las 5 de la mañana no te responde nadie.
  • Foros: Si nadie te responde al momento, deja tu mensaje en nuestro foro de libre acceso después de oir la señal... Beep!

Mono en GNome?????

Buenas a tod@s:

Escribo este artículo para ver que opinan los miembros de Gulic sobre un tema sobre el cual tengo unas dudas.

GNome esta pensando en poner más software realizado con Mono por defecto en su instalación de escritorio, esto desde mi punto de vista puede ser un error porque Microsoft tiene alguna patente sobre C# y estas aplicaciones están basadas en C#.

Si algún día Microsoft le da por hacer validas sus patentes, ¿que podría pasarle a GNome? ¿Debería quitar todo el software de GNome basado en Mono?.

Desde mi punto de vista se debería potenciar por parte de GNome las aplicaciones realizadas por ejemplo bajo Python, para eliminar cualquier tipo de riesgo, luego que los usuarios que lo deseen se instalen el software que quieran.

¿Que opina la gente de Gulic?

Un saludo.

Imagen de aplatanado

Re: Mono en GNome?????

Bueno era sabido que tarde o temprano GNOME daría ese paso. GNOME hace mucho tiempo que está buscando la comunicación transparente de las aplicaciones independientemente del lenguaje con el que está programadas. Así, por ejemplo, aunque GTK (la biblioteca de Widgets que una GNOME) y otras muchas bibliotecas de GNOME están hechas en C (convirtiendo a este lenguaje en el preferido para programar par GNOME), el proyecto a dedicado mucho tiempo a hacer bindings para programar en otros lenguaje y a desarrollar Corba como mecanismo de comunicación entre procesos independiente del lenguaje.

Sin embargo no deja de ser complejo mantener todos esos bindings. Y Corba se muestra muy lento para la comunicaciones de aplicaciones de escritorio. Así que Icaza desde el principio vio en .NET la solución a todos estos problemas. Una máquina virtual para la que poder compilar cualquier programa independientemente del lenguaje que se use (en java ahora se puede hacer eso, pero en aquel momento tal posibilidad se usa prácticamente de forma anecdótica). Y sobre todo la posibilidad de hacer una biblioteca en el lenguaje A (por ejemplo C#) y enlazarla con un programa en lenguaje B (por ejemplo Python) para que corran sobre Mono. Así que es normal y se veía venir que esto pasaría. Simplemente Mono resuelve un problema que los de GNOME piensan que tienen desde hace tiempo.

¿Es esto conveniente para GNU/Linux? No lo se. El mayor problema como comentas son las patentes pero en algunos foros dicen que esto no es un problema. Yo estoy convencido de que si puede serlo pero estoy esperando a que alguien me explique porque las patentes de Microsoft nunca podrá poner al proyecto GNOME en dificultades.

Un saludo.


May the Free Software Force be with you…

Re: Mono en GNome?????

Buenas:

Aplatanado referente a lo que comentabas que aún estas esperando que alguien te explique porque las patentes de microsoft no son problema, aquí te pongo un enlace que igual no te lo explica, pero que te confirma que el mundo Linux esta moviéndose hacía Mono.

http://www.vivalinux.com.ar/distros/ubuntu-y-mono

En el anuncio se cita a la gente de Ubuntu para informar del porque decir Sí a Mono desde Ubuntu.

Un saludo.

http://ideassinmarcar.blogspot.com

Imagen de aplatanado

Re: Mono en GNome?????

Bueno yo por esto no diría que Linux se está moviendo a Mono. Lo que si es cierto es que GNOME es el escritorio de Ubuntu y, quizás por su apoyo corporativo, sea realmente el escritorio más extendido. Por tanto es normal que si GNOME tira para Mono muchos proyectos acaben optando por Mono.

Un saludo.


May the Free Software Force be with you…

Re: Mono en GNome?????

Una cosa que hay que tener en cuenta es la génesis de Gnome y de Mono. De Icaza es un admirador confeso de Microsoft y su forma de hacer las cosas (me refiero en cuanto a programación, no a tácticas empresariales). Gnome surgió del convencimiento de de Icaza de que el futuro estaba hecho de componentes, como en las tripas de Windows. Por eso Corba y toda la pesca. Y tuvo éxito porque no había un escritorio libre alternativo (en aquel momento KDE no se podía considerar libre del todo por el famoso problema de las QT de entonces). Por eso Gnome tiene ese regustillo a Windows.
Luego vino C#. Y Ahora ha venido Silverlight. En ambos casos, Miguel “winfan” de Icaza corrió a hacer el juego a los de la mariposa y crear versiones supuestamente libres de ambos, Mono y Moonlight. En realidad, eso solamente viene a hacerle el juego a Microsoft, permitiéndoles seguir marcando el tempo del universo informático. ¿Por qué estamos todos pendientes de un tema así pudiendo dedicar nuestro tiempo a otras cosas? Porque le seguimos el juego a alguien que le sigue el paso a Microsoft.

Lo peor es cómo quedamos los usuarios de escritorios. O pasamos por el aro de KDE 4 (un monstruo) o por el de Mono en Gnome (otro monstruo). Casi me estoy pensando dejar de usar escritorios y volver a sistemas de ventanas y programas agnósticos (en cuanto al escritorio).


Estoy hasta los OO de Linux y de GULiC.

…simplemente, Windows y Google me caen aún peor.

Re: Mono en GNome?????

Por cierto he leido hoy que ya Debian ha dicho que no va a incluir Mono en la instalación por defecto.

Imagen de aplatanado

Re: Mono en GNome?????

En la instalación por defecto no pero es que eso no tendría sentido. Lo normal es que Mono se instale si se instala un paquete que depende de él. Si no ¿para qué sirve el sistema de dependencias de los paquetes?


May the Free Software Force be with you…

Opciones de visualización de comentarios

Seleccione la forma que prefiera para mostrar los comentarios y haga clic en «Guardar las opciones» para activar los cambios.